Coming Soon: Limbofest’s “Wewe” To Drop on YouTube

If you’ve been scrolling through TikTok lately, chances are you’ve caught a glimpse of something exciting brewing in the music scene. That’s right, we’re talking about Limbofest’s highly anticipated new single, “Wewe.” With teasers dropping left and right, fans are diving into challenges, showing off their best dance moves, and just enjoying the infectious vibe this track brings! The audio of “Wewe” is already live on major digital streaming platforms, and buzz is building as we await the music video, which is set to drop on March 21, 2025. So mark your calendars! The guys at Limbofest have truly kept us on our toes since their previous hit “Baddie,” featuring Heavy Cane and Sukre. Their knack for combining incredible afro-fused beats with catchy lyrics never fails to entertain, and “Wewe” is no exception! Unspoken Salaton’s “Sina Mtu”: The Anthem for the Broke and Beautiful Single Life

In a world obsessed with relationships and extravagant lifestyles, Unspoken Salaton and Joefes offer a refreshing antidote with their new single, “Sina Mtu” (meaning “I Don’t Have Anyone”). This catchy tune, described as “Adult Cocomelon,” embraces the joys of being single and broke, celebrating the freedom and simplicity that comes with it. “Sina Mtu” bursts onto the scene with an infectiously upbeat melody that instantly transports you back to your carefree childhood days. The song’s rhythm is reminiscent of those familiar preschool tracks, creating a sense of comfort and nostalgia. The lyrics, sung in Swahili, playfully detail the struggles and triumphs of navigating life without a significant other and without a hefty bank account. The accompanying music video, directed by Chemy, mirrors the song’s lightheartedness. It features Unspoken Salaton and Joefes dancing with an infectious energy, their expressions a mix of playful mischief and genuine enjoyment. The simplicity of the video, with its vibrant colors and uncomplicated choreography, perfectly complements the song’s message. It’s a reminder that joy can be found in the most unexpected places, even in the midst of financial constraints and singlehood. Unspoken Salaton, known for their unique blend of Afrobeat and contemporary sounds, has been garnering praise for their music. Their previous releases have been met with critical acclaim and have garnered a dedicated fanbase. “Sina Mtu,” however, marks a new chapter for the group. It’s The Week End, “Tushike County”

“Tushike County” is more than just a catchy phrase; it’s a cultural phenomenon sweeping across Kenya’s youth. It’s a declaration of fun, a call to action, and a celebration of a particular beverage that has become synonymous with good times. The song itself, released by a collaboration of artists including Joefes, Unspoken Salaton, Diaso (Tiktoker), and Only One Delo, perfectly encapsulates this youthful energy. Their previous hits “Guza” and “Starehe” proved their ability to connect with audiences, and “Tushike County” continues this trend, creating a vibrant soundtrack for the Kenyan youth’s nightlife. The music video, released on Youtube, is a visual representation of the song’s message. The artists are seen enjoying their “Counties,” each holding a tumbler filled with the drink that has become synonymous with their lifestyle. “Mwache” is Your New Anthem for Ditching the Drama

Tired of the emotional rollercoaster? Feeling like you’re stuck in a toxic loop? Well, listen up because “Mwache,” the new track by Heavy Cane and Teslah, is here to be your ultimate breakup anthem! This ain’t your average break-up song; it’s a powerful declaration of self-worth and a rallying cry to ditch the drama and embrace the good vibes. Heavy Cane and Teslah are serving up some serious realness with lyrics like “Akikusumbua muache, Sisi huku nje twakusubiri” (If they’re bothering you, leave them, we’re waiting for you out here). The song’s message resonates deeply with Kenya’s youth, who are all about self-expression and authenticity. It’s a reminder that you deserve better, and you don’t have to settle for anything less than happiness. “Mwache” isn’t just a song; it’s a movement. It’s a call to action to reclaim your power and step away from negativity. And with its catchy amapiano beats, courtesy of DJ Moon, it’s guaranteed to get you moving your feet and feeling empowered.
